Call Center Software 101: An Introduction to Customer Contact Technology

Noble Systems

A call center is a centralized site that is equipped to manage a large volume of customer contacts – both incoming and outgoing – for an organization. The heart of the call center is its people, often called representatives, or agents, who are on the front-line of these communications. What Is Call Center Software?
